The Samsung Galaxy Note4 is a little bit better than the Asus ZenFone Max Pro (M2), having a 77.6 score against 77.4. The Samsung Galaxy Note4 construction has the same thickness than Asus ZenFone Max Pro (M2), but it is a bit heavier. Galaxy Note4 has a little more vivid screen than Asus ZenFone Max Pro (M2), because although it has a bit smaller display, it also counts with a higher pixels density and a better 1440 x 2560 resolution.
The Asus ZenFone Max Pro (M2) counts with a little faster processing unit than Samsung Galaxy Note4, and although they both have 8 CPU cores, the Asus ZenFone Max Pro (M2) also has a larger amount of RAM memory. Asus ZenFone Max Pro (M2) has a way bigger memory capacity to store more games and applications than Samsung Galaxy Note4, because it has 96 GB more internal storage capacity and a SD extension slot that admits up to 1,95 TB.
The Asus ZenFone Max Pro (M2) counts with a way better battery performance than Galaxy Note4, because it has a 55% bigger battery size. Galaxy Note4 features just a bit better camera than Asus ZenFone Max Pro (M2), because although it has a tinier aperture, and they both have the same video resolution and the same 30 frames per second video frame rates, the Galaxy Note4 also counts with a bigger back camera sensor taking better quality pictures and a camera in the back with a much higher 16 megapixels resolution.
